After back to back defensive embarrassments the Steelers defense came to play against the NFL’s top scoring offense forcing six turnovers while sacking Daniel Jones five times in a 27-20 win over the Indianapolis Colts,

The Broncos are the first team in NFL history with at least 35 sacks on defense and 10 or fewer sacks allowed on offense in the first eight games of a season.
Josh Allen combined for three touchdowns to outduel Patrick Mahomes, and the Buffalo Bills defeated the Chiefs 28-21 in a rematch of last season’s AFC championship game won by Kansas City.
